About This Site

SADDS WHARFS STATION ROAD MALDON is a brownfield development site covering 2.07 hectares in Maldon. The site has potential for up to 93 new homes.

The site has full planning permission, granted on 30/11/2012.

Additional Notes

Mixed use development comprising 93 residential units (mix of 1, 2 and 3 bedroom apartments and houses), Office accomodation (1480msq Class B1 Business units) and Leisure accomodation (680msq Classes A3, A4, A5 and D1 restaurants, Public House, bars, take-a-ways and non-residential institutions i.e health centre, creche, day nurseries, museum, libaries, place of worship or non-residetial education)

What is Brownfield Land?

Brownfield land is previously developed land that may be available for redevelopment. The government prioritises brownfield development over greenfield sites to protect countryside and make efficient use of existing infrastructure. Local authorities maintain Brownfield Land Registers to identify suitable sites for housing.
